Title: National VOC Emission Standards for Consumer Products 
Abstract: Section 183(e) of the Clean Air Act requires that EPA list those categories of consumer and commercial products (CCPs) that account for at least 80 percent of volatile organic compounds (VOC) from all CCPs in ozone nonattainment areas. The list is to be divided into 4 groups by priority. The EPA is to regulate one group of categories every 2 years until all 4 groups are regulated. The first group must be regulated no later than 2 years after the EPA publishes the list and regulatory schedule. ^PThe EPA has listed for regulation a group of 24 products which are currently regulated by California and several other States. The rule would set VOC content limits for the 24 categories of products. These limitations are currently being met by product manufacturers marketing products in California and other States. A Federal rule would provide consistency and would assist other States in achieving VOC reductions toward their 15-percent rate-of-progress requirements. This rule is supported by both the States and by the consumer products industry.
